Nashik: After the Nashik Municipal Corporation (NMC) issued closure notices to 416 private nursing homes, 238 of them have applied for renewal of their licences. The remaining hospitals are expected to renew their licences in the coming few days or else they would be forced to shut down.There are as many as 654 hospitals, clinics, maternity and nursing homes registered with the NMC of which 416 are yet to renew their licences — a mandatory process in every three years.“Out of the 416 nursing and maternity homes that we had sent notices to, 238 have applied for renewal of licences. The files are still coming to us for renewal,” said an NMC official.The official added that they had time till April 15 to get the licences renewed. “We have given April 15 as the deadline of the closure notice. After that we will close down the nursing and maternity homes,” said the official.The NMC had issued notices earlier to health care establishments to get the licences renewed, but the owners allegedly failed to do so. Now, after the final notices giving an ultimatum of April 15 got them into action. “Rules for renewal like change in use of the property, widening staircases and other norms were declared in 1995. We started informing the health establishments about it some years ago. Also, they have to abide by the fire safety norms. We hope to have more applications for renewal by April 15, or else these would be closed down for sure,” said the official.Meanwhile, the NMC also started inspecting sonography centres from Monday and scrutinised 35 centres. The 268 sonography centres are being inspected to see if any of them are involved in sex determination. “We will be summarising our findings of all these centres by May 1. Action against erring sonography centres will be taken after we summarise the data,” said the NMC official.
